Where is storage located in a power plant?
Storage can be located at a power plant, as a stand-alone resource on the transmission system, on the distribution system and at a customer's premise behind the meter. Do wind and solar need storage? All power systems need flexibility, and this need increases with increased levels of wind and solar.
Does compressed air energy storage reduce wind and solar power curtailment?
Compressed air energy storage (CAES) effectively reduces wind and solar power curtailment due to randomness. However, inaccurate daily data and improper storage capacity configuration impact CAES development.
What is dedicated energy storage?
Dedicated energy storage ignores the realities of both grid operation and the performance of a large, spatially diverse renewable energy source. Because power systems are balanced at the system level, no dedicated backup with energy storage is needed for any single technology.
Is energy storage flexible?
There are many sources of flexibility and grid services: energy storage is a particularly versatile one. Various types of energy storage technologies exist, addressing flexibility needs across different time scales. What are the benefits of storage? Storage shifts energy in time.
